Job Training for Tech-Savvy Workforce

In today’s rapidly changing job market, particularly in sectors influenced by technological advancement, job training initiatives have become paramount. Grants within this field are designed to equip individuals with essential digital skills and competencies that align with the needs of modern employers. This funding specifically supports programs that provide training and certification for in-demand roles, including those in technology and digital services. Importantly, this grant does not cover training programs unrelated to technological skill enhancement or those lacking a clear connection to job placement.

An illustrative case of effective grant utilization can be seen in a partnership formed between local community colleges and regional tech companies to deliver a comprehensive coding boot camp. This program successfully upskilled participants, many of whom transitioned into full-time employment within weeks of completion. Another example includes a grant-funded initiative that offered digital marketing training for small business owners who struggled to navigate the online marketplace.

Grants of this nature are typically aimed at educational institutions, non-profits focused on workforce development, and recognized training providers that can showcase a direct link between training outcomes and employment rates. Organizations whose programs do not directly result in job readiness or fail to address specific workforce gaps may find themselves ineligible for funding.

The operational landscape for receiving such grants necessitates realistic implementation strategies. Resource requirements entail a well-structured budget for equipment and training materials, qualified personnel to deliver training, and a timeline that allows integration with local employers. Commonly encountered pitfalls include insufficient outreach to potential trainees and inadequate metrics for assessing the training impact on employment, both of which can jeopardize future funding opportunities.
